Factors that affect the cost of the Mi Band 6

The first thing that catches your eye when you look up this gadget online is the huge price range. What does it depend on? The key factor is the division into Global Version and NFC Version. The conventional version is designed for the international market and has only basic activity and health tracking functionality. The NFC version is usually targeted at the Chinese market, although hybrid options are also available, and it costs significantly more because of the built-in contactless payment chip.

The second important aspect is the packaging and the instruction. Global versions come in a box with multilingual instructions, including Russian, and often have a sticker with a different language. QR-The Chinese version of the code is authentication (CN Version) may come in plain packaging or with instructions in Chinese and English only, which reduces their total cost to the seller, but may cause inconvenience to the user.

The official delivery to Russia or CIS countries will always cost higher, since the price includes customs duties, logistics and mandatory service.Grey" deliveries brought by private order or small batches, allow you to save, but deprive the buyer of a convenient local guarantee.

⚠️ Note: If the price of Xiaomi Mi Band 6 in a large chain store is significantly lower than the market average, this may indicate a refurbished device or a product with defective packaging that other customers returned.

Before the holidays or the release of a new model (for example, Mi Band 7 or 8), retailers can arrange sales of old sewage, temporarily reducing the price by 15-20%, at which time the purchase becomes the most profitable.

Price difference: Global Version vs NFC

Many users are asking themselves, should you overpay for the NFC version? The price difference between the regular Global version and the NFC version can be anywhere from 500 to 1,500 rubles. But what do you get for that money?

The NFC version is equipped with a contactless chip, but in Russia and many CIS countries, this functionality in conjunction with the Mi Band 6 does not officially work with local banking systems (Mir Pay and analogues), you can only use NFC to unlock a laptop or smart lock if they support Xiaomi protocols, but you can not pay for a purchase in a store β€œfrom the wrist”.

Can I replay the CN version in Global?
Technically, this is possible, but the process requires special skills, is risky for the beginner and can lead to the β€œbricking” of the device, and after reflashing the Chinese version will not magically support payment with cards of Russian banks.

The regular Global Version is stripped of this module, but fully supports Russian in the Zepp Life menu and app (formerly Mi Fit).For the 90% of users who need an activity, sleep and pulse tracker, overpaying for NFC makes no practical sense, unless you plan to use the bracelet for specific smart home tasks.

So if you're offered a version of NFC that's priced well above the global one, make sure you really need it, otherwise you're just giving money for the unnecessary hardware.

How to distinguish the original from the fake by price and appearance

The popularity of the Xiaomi Mi Band 6 has spawned a huge number of copies. Counterfeiting can cost two to three times less than the original, but their build quality, screen and health sensors leave much to be desired. How not to become a victim of fraud?

First, look at the screen. The original is used. AMOLED-It's a matrix with a deep black color and a high brightness. IPS cheap OLED, where black is gray and the viewing angles are limited, and fakes often lack automatic brightness control.

  • πŸ” Packaging: The original always has high-quality printing, clear fonts and sealed in a branded film with a hologram (not always, but often).
  • πŸ” Package: The box should only have the tracker (capsule) and strap. There is no charger in the kit (magnetic charging is used), but sometimes strange ones are placed in fakes. USB-cable.
  • πŸ” The original bracelet is paired only through official Zepp Life or Mi Fitness apps. Fakes often require the installation of left-handed apps with a sleeve-based interface. QR-code-in.

If the price of the new Mi Band 6 is 1000-1200 rubles, it is almost guaranteed a fake or a device with a broken screen, which was sold as a new one.

⚠️ Warning: Never buy a wristband if the seller claims to download the app from a link in the paper manual. Official apps are only available on Google Play and the App Store.

Cost of ownership and additional costs

Buying the device itself is just the first expense. Although the Mi Band 6 does not require subscriptions for basic work, it is worth considering the potential costs in the future. For example, replacing the strap. The original straps cost from 300 to 800 rubles, while quality analogues can be found for 150-200 rubles.

Another point is screen protection, because the display is large and covers almost the entire area of the capsule, it is prone to scratches, and buying a protective film or glass (about 200-300 rubles) is a reasonable investment that will preserve the appearance and liquidity of the device if you decide to sell it.

It is also worth considering that the battery degrades over time. After 2-3 years of active use, autonomy can fall from 14 days to 5-7 days. Replacing the battery in the service can cost from 500 to 1000 rubles, which is a significant part of the cost of a new device.

FAQ: Frequently Asked Questions

Can I use the Mi Band 6 without a smartphone?
You can't use a wristband without a smartphone. Initial settings, time synchronization, and firmware updates require you to connect to your phone through an app. Without a phone, it's just a clock that shows the time (if it's installed), but it won't store and analyze the statistics of steps and sleep.
Is there a price difference between black and colored bands?
Usually, the version with a black silicone strap is the cheapest.Completions with colored straps (orange, olive, blue) or special editions (for example, Nike) can cost 200-500 rubles more expensive in retail chains, although on AliExpress the difference is often minimal.
How long will the Mi Band 6 really last?
When used carefully, the device lasts 2-3 years. The main limiting factor is the battery. The screen and sensors fail less often, usually due to mechanical damage or moisture ingress during diving (despite the declared protection of 5 ATM).
Does the Mi Band 6 work with an iPhone?
Yes, the bracelet is fully compatible with iOS (starting with iPhone 5s and iOS 10.0), and is almost identical to Android, except for some iOS limitations, such as the inability to respond to messages directly from the bracelet (only view).
Do I need to buy a safety glass immediately?
It's not necessary, but it's highly desirable. The Mi Band 6 screen is large and easily scratches with keys or doorjambs. Screen replacement is not possible (only the capsule changes entirely), so film or glass is a cheap way to extend the life of the device.
